I assume by electronic sights you mean items like a Red Dot sight? I have one on my FA 475 Linebaugh and love it. Essential for accuracy at longer ranges IMHO. Mine is an UltraDot. More expensive but better for high recoiling guns. Many now favor the 'reflex" type red dot sight but I do not own one. There are many red dot sights available quite cheaply on eBay. These should be perfectly adequate for a 22RF but, for high recoiling guns, pay for quality and make sure they are securely mounted.

I use a trijicon RMR on my FA 454 casull
No issues and I shoot better with it. For old eyes it is better than irons and a scope is too dim at last legal light.
